I] E elearningmines'edu '1') C Exam37519ipdf Not found Begins with CODE - BCDJHJ - PHGNlOO, Introductory Mechanics, Spring 2019 7 Exam 3 6 point(s) A block of mass 1.8 kg is attached to a string that is wrapped around a pulley and then attached on the other side to a spring as shown. The pulley is a uniform solid cylinder of mass mp = 2.53 kg and radius R = 0.34 m. At rst the block is held so the spring is unstretched. You then let the block go. As the block falls, the rope and pulley move together without slipping. What is the speed of the block after it has fallen a distance d = 0.38 m if the spring constant equals 31.5 N / m?
